Quote[/b] (kekvitirae @ May 28 2003,10:08)]New units and new factions are easy enough, but changing your general's name can be tricky, unless you dont mind his name being randomly generated from a list.
Actually in VI you can not only choose a name for your General or any other office i.e. Spy,Emissary, etc. but you can also match him to a portrait by using the HEROES DEFAULT FILE in Campamp/Names I am in the process of adding Generals to the Napoleonic Mod for VI we have added Napoleon , Duke Of Wellington and many others with Name, Correct portrait and stats of our choosing. With this file you are able to work around the Randomly generated names in the Loc/Eng/Nmaes files. http://www.totalwar.org/forum/non-cgi/emoticons/biggrin.gif
